Delicious apple cinnamon crumb cake is the perfect dessert for fall or great as a breakfast cake.
The best part of a crumb cake is that crumb topping! Not only do you have it on the top, but also layered between the cake and apple layers.
When you start to make this cake you will think that you don’t have enough cake batter, the first layer you put down will be really thin and then you will add crumbs and apples and top with the remaining cake batter. Don’t worry it will be enough, this cake is really dense and it doesn’t get too much of a rise but it is jam packed with flavor and you are doing a great job even though it looks different than most cakes do.
This cake fits perfectly in an 8-inch round pan. Â If you have a springform pan it will be even easier for you. Â If you don’t, no worries, just be sure to spray your pan really well and run a knife around the edges before taking out or you can just serve it right out of your pan.
And one more thing before I give you the recipe. Â When making your glaze, if you don’t have apple cider you can also use some apple juice and it will be just fine. Enjoy!

- Heat oven to 350 F. Grease 8-inch springform pan and line the bottom with parchment paper, set aside.
- To make cinnamon streusel crumb, in a medium bowl whisk together dry ingredients. Add melted butter and vanilla and stir until the mixture is evenly moist, set aside.
- Make the cake in a large bowl, cream together 4 tbsp butter with 1/2 cup sugar until light and fluffy, then add egg and beat well. Add vanilla and sour cream and beat again.
- In a small bowl, stir together 1 cup flour, baking soda, salt, and baking powder and add to the butter mixture, stir until just combined.
- Spread half the batter at the bottom of the pan ( it will be very thin layer). Spread the apple chunks evenly over the batter, then sprinkle about 1 cup of the cinnamon streusel crumbs over the apples. Spread the remaining batter over the crumbs and on top spread the rest of the cinnamon streusel.
- Bake 30-35 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- Before removing the ring of springform pan run a thin knife around the cake.
- To make the glaze, whisk together powdered sugar with apple cider and drizzle over the cake.
